ADOdb is a database abstraction library for PHP and Python based on the same concept as Microsoft's ActiveX Data Objects. It allows developers to write applications in a fairly consistent way regardless of the underlying database storing the information. The advantage is that the database can be changed without re-writing every call to it in the application.
| Property | Value |
| dbpedia-owl:Software#license
| |
| p:abstract
| - ADOdb is a database abstraction library for PHP and Python based on the same concept as Microsoft's ActiveX Data Objects. It allows developers to write applications in a fairly consistent way regardless of the underlying database storing the information. The advantage is that the database can be changed without re-writing every call to it in the application.
From the [http://adodb.sourceforge.net/ ADOdb website] and developer sites, it supports the following databases:
*ActiveX Data Objects*
*DB2
*Firebird
*Foxpro
*FrontBase
*Informix
*Interbase
*LDAP
*Microsoft Access
*Microsoft SQL Server
*MySQL
*Netezza
*Oracle
*PostgreSQL
*SAP DB
*SQLite
*Sybase
*Teradata
* Valentina
*generic ODBC and ODBTP
ADOdb uses SQL. Since each database implements SQL slightly differently, the developer will need to be aware of the database-specific features and functions to avoid if they want to maintain portability. ADOdb provides date conversion functions so that you can create dates in any format and insert them into your SQL in the correct format for your database; which is one step toward database independent SQL.
Some databases support the Limit phrase which first appeared in MySQL and is now part of SQL. ADOdb's SelectLimit( ) translates limit to different mechanisms for each database and can emulate limit for databases with no native limit equivalent. Translations will perform efficiently. Emulations may work slowly by returning too many rows then using only those that meet the limit.
ADOdb has variables that contain the correct SQL for a database for specific functions. For example, to check for a null value, null can be replaced with the ADOdb variable that contains the correct SQL definition for null and the check for null will work in every database. (en)
- ADOdb es un conjunto de librerías de bases de datos para PHP y Python. Esta permite a los programadores desarrollar aplicaciones web de una manera portable, rápida y fácil. La ventaja reside en que la base de datos puede cambiar sin necesidad de reescribir cada llamada a la base de datos realizada por la aplicación.
Según el [http://adodb.sourceforge.net/ Sitio Oficial de ADOdb], son soportadas las siguientes bases de datos:
*MySQL
*PostgreSQL
*Interbase
*Firebird
*Informix
*Oracle
*MS SQL
*Foxpro
*Access
*ADO*
*Sybase ASE
*FrontBase
*DB2
*SAP DB
*SQLite
*Netezza
*LDAP
*generic ODBC and ODBTP
Cabe notar que ADOdb usa SQL. Teniendo en cuenta que cada base de datos implementa SQL de una manera levemente diferente, es trabajo del desarrollador prestar cuidadosa atención a las características y funciones específicas de la base de datos para mantener la portabilidad del código. (es)
- ADOdb ist eine Sammlung von Datenbank-Abstraktions-Funktionen oder Database abstraction layer. Das Konzept ähnelt etwa Microsofts ActiveX Data Objects. Sie ermöglicht dem Programmierer, Anwendungen unabhängig von der Datenspeicherung zugrundeliegenden Datenbank zu schreiben. Der Vorteil ist, dass Anwendungen bei einem Wechsel der Datenbank nicht komplett neu geschrieben werden müssen. Allerdings muss darauf geachtet werden, dass einige Datenbanken nicht alle Funktionen unterstützen.
Es gibt Versionen für PHP und Python, wobei die Python-Version noch nicht so weit fortgeschritten ist. (de)
- ADOdb est une bibliothèque d'abstraction destinée à communiquer avec différents systèmes de gestion de base de données (SGDB). Écrite au début en, il existe également une version en Python. (fr)
- ADOdb (Active Data Objects DataBase - Obiektowa Baza Danych) to interfejs pozwalający na komunikację z bazą danych. Pozwala on na komunikację pomiędzy skryptem napisanym w języku PHP a praktycznie dowolną z popularnych baz danych: MySQL, PostgreSQL, Oracle, Interbase, Microsoft SQL Server, Access, FoxPro, Sybase, ODBC i ADO.
Użytkownik ADODB nie łączy się bezpośrednio z bazą danych, lecz z właśnie z ADODB. Ono z kolei komunikuje się z odpowiednią bazą w jej języku. Dzięki temu nie trzeba pisać oddzielnego kodu dla każdej bazy danych. (pl)
- ADOdb - это библиотека абстрактных классов, написанная на PHP и Python основанная на некоторых концепциях от Microsoft's ActiveX Data Objects. Она позволяет разработчикам писать приложения максимально правильно с точки зрения концептуального подхода к работе с хранилищами данных. В результате у разработчика появляется возможность изменить СУБД без необходимости вносить исправления в программный код приложения.
Библиотека позволяет работать со следующими СУБД:
*Access
*ActiveX Data Objects
*DB2
*Firebird
*Foxpro
*FrontBase
*Informix
*Interbase
*LDAP
*Microsoft SQL Server
*MySQL
*Netezza
*Oracle
*PostgreSQL
*SAP DB
*SQLite
*Sybase
*Teradata
* Valentina
*общий ODBC и ODBTP
ADOdb использует SQL. (ru)
- ADOdb是Active Data Objects database的简称,它是一种PHP存取数据库的函式组件。它允许程序员以一致的方式来存取数据库,从而忽略后台数据库的种类的差异。它的优势是能让程序员在转移数据库平台时,可以不用花费大量时间重新书写代码。它支持以下数据库:
MySQL、PostgreSQL、Interbase、Firebird、Informix、Oracle、MS SQL、Foxpro、Access、ADO、Sybase、FrontBase、DB2、SAP DB、SQLite、Netezza、LDAP以及一般ODBC、ODBTP。 (zh)
|
| p:genre
| - Database abstraction library (en)
|
| p:hasPhotoCollection
| |
| p:license
| |
| p:name
| |
| p:portalProperty
| |
| p:programmingLanguage
| |
| p:reference
| |
| p:website
| |
| p:wikiPageUsesTemplate
| |
| p:wikipage-de
| |
| p:wikipage-es
| |
| p:wikipage-fr
| |
| p:wikipage-pl
| |
| p:wikipage-ru
| |
| p:wikipage-zh
| |
| rdf:type
| |
| rdfs:comment
| - ADOdb is a database abstraction library for PHP and Python based on the same concept as Microsoft's ActiveX Data Objects. It allows developers to write applications in a fairly consistent way regardless of the underlying database storing the information. The advantage is that the database can be changed without re-writing every call to it in the application. (en)
- ADOdb es un conjunto de librerías de bases de datos para PHP y Python. Esta permite a los programadores desarrollar aplicaciones web de una manera portable, rápida y fácil. La ventaja reside en que la base de datos puede cambiar sin necesidad de reescribir cada llamada a la base de datos realizada por la aplicación. (es)
- ADOdb ist eine Sammlung von Datenbank-Abstraktions-Funktionen oder Database abstraction layer. Das Konzept ähnelt etwa Microsofts ActiveX Data Objects. Sie ermöglicht dem Programmierer, Anwendungen unabhängig von der Datenspeicherung zugrundeliegenden Datenbank zu schreiben. Der Vorteil ist, dass Anwendungen bei einem Wechsel der Datenbank nicht komplett neu geschrieben werden müssen. Allerdings muss darauf geachtet werden, dass einige Datenbanken nicht alle Funktionen unterstützen. (de)
- ADOdb est une bibliothèque d'abstraction destinée à communiquer avec différents systèmes de gestion de base de données (SGDB). Écrite au début en, il existe également une version en Python. (fr)
- ADOdb (Active Data Objects DataBase - Obiektowa Baza Danych) to interfejs pozwalający na komunikację z bazą danych. Pozwala on na komunikację pomiędzy skryptem napisanym w języku PHP a praktycznie dowolną z popularnych baz danych: MySQL, PostgreSQL, Oracle, Interbase, Microsoft SQL Server, Access, FoxPro, Sybase, ODBC i ADO. (pl)
- ADOdb - это библиотека абстрактных классов, написанная на PHP и Python основанная на некоторых концепциях от Microsoft's ActiveX Data Objects. Она позволяет разработчикам писать приложения максимально правильно с точки зрения концептуального подхода к работе с хранилищами данных. (ru)
- ADOdb是Active Data Objects database的简称,它是一种PHP存取数据库的函式组件。它允许程序员以一致的方式来存取数据库,从而忽略后台数据库的种类的差异。它的优势是能让程序员在转移数据库平台时,可以不用花费大量时间重新书写代码。它支持以下数据库: (zh)
|
| rdfs:label
| - ADOdb (en)
- ADOdb (es)
- ADOdb (de)
- ADOdb (fr)
- ADOdb (pl)
- ADOdb (ru)
- ADOdb (zh)
|
| skos:subject
| |
| foaf:homepage
| |
| foaf:page
| |
| p:redirect
| |
| owl:sameAs
| |